The Forsyth County Board of Commissioners has elected officers for 2013.

District 1 Commissioner R.J. (Pete) Amos was elected chairman. District 5 Commissioner Jim Boff, who served the past year as chairman, was named vice chairman, and District 2 Commissioner Brian Tam was elected secretary.

The Board of Commissioners is made up of five members, each living in a specific district and elected to serve four-year terms.
